This inoculation method cannot control the air temperature and relative humidity, thus affecting the inoculation effect; at the same time, the natural inoculation experimenters cannot accurately grasp the inoculation time and the infection occurrence time, and cannot observe and collect the physiological changes of infected plants at specific time points before inoculation and after inoculation. Changes in biochemical indicators
Manual inoculation requires the manual isolation and cultivation of the gray spot pathogenic bacteria. Under the environmental conditions of the field or greenhouse, the inoculation is completed by artificial spraying, injection of the carrier solution, or insertion of the carrier carrier into the plant body, and induces the disease of the plant. The inoculation Although the method can accurately control the inoculation time, and can also obtain the purified gray spot pathogenic bacteria through the steps of pathogenic bacteria isolation and cultivation, but the artificial inoculation of infected plants is limited by seasons and regions, and can only be used in specific seasons that meet the growth of corn (such as spring and summer). ) for field identification, the air temperature and relative humidity changes after plant inoculation cannot be controlled, the inoculation host is difficult to get sick, and the success rate of inoculation is not high; in addition, the gray spot pathogen grows slowly under artificial conditions, and it is easy to be polluted during the cultivation period. [0016] 1. Inoculation method of corn gray spot disease

[0017] (1) corn plant transplanting in the bell mouth stage: the corn plant in the bell mouth stage is transplanted with soil to a diameter of 50 cm, and in a flowerpot of 60 cm deep;

[0018] (2) Cultivate under the artificial climate incubator simulation environment: place the transplanted plants in the artificial climate incubator, set the ambient temperature to 25°C, the relative humidity to 95%, the day time to 12 hours, the light intensity to 2500 Lx, and the night time to be 12 hours , the light intensity was OLx, and the plants were cultivated in the artificial climate chamber for 9 days, and the plants returned to normal growth.

[0019] (3) Collection of pathogenic bacteria: ① water soaking is the first choice: soak 20g of leaves with typical lesions of gray spot with 50ml distilled water, soak for 4 hours, filter the leaf residue, collect soaked distilled water; ② then wash with water: repeatedly wash with new...

Abstract

An inoculation method for corn gray spot disease, comprising the following steps: (1) transplanting corn plants at the trumpet-mouth stage; (2) cultivating in a real simulated environment in an artificial climate incubator; (3) collecting pathogenic bacteria; 4) inoculating. The invention is not limited by factors such as season, external environment and region, effectively improves the success rate of artificial inoculation of gray spot disease, can accurately control the inoculation time of gray spot disease, and is beneficial to observe and detect specific time nodes before and after inoculation of plants The appearance and internal indicators change dynamically.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to an inoculation method for plant gray spot disease, in particular to an inoculation method for corn gray spot disease. Background technique [0002] Maize gray spot disease is one of the main diseases in corn production areas. As the damage caused by gray spot disease in corn production increases year by year, the research on corn gray spot disease is also deepening. In recent years, the research on corn gray spot resistance mainly covers the research on the pathogenic mechanism of gray spot disease, the pathogenicity of pathogenic bacteria, the identification of plant disease resistance, and the location and cloning of resistance genes. It is used to realize the infection of corn plants by pathogenic bacteria through natural inoculation or artificial inoculation, and then cause diseases, so that researchers can track and investigate the whole process of disease.
